Tissue-inhibitors of metalloproteinase-1 and vascular-endothelial growth-factor in severe haemophilia A children on low dose prophylactic recombinant factor VIII: Relation to subclinical arthropathy.

Nevine Gamal AndrawesHossam Mousa SakerNouran Yousef Salah El-DinMervat Abd Elhakim Hussain
Published in: Haemophilia : the official journal of the World Federation of Hemophilia (2020)
Vascular endothelial growth factor and TIMP-1 can be used for early detection of HA. Further prospective studies should include larger study populations. In addition, studies should address the role of various anti-VEGFs as potential therapy for HA and their impact on prevention and treatment of HA.
